WitrynaVocê já parou para imaginar que na sua região possa ter ouro e que você pode se dar muito bem. Witryna5 wrz 2024 · Options are generally separated by commas. Example. You can have chicken, beef, or fish. In your example there are two options: either you have read the book, or you have just heard of it. You have probably read The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o, or at least heard of it. The two options are correctly separated by a comma.

You do not need a comma … WitrynaShould There Be A Comma After “Please Note”? You should not place a comma after “ please note .”. The full phrase should always be “please note that.” “That” replaces the need for a comma, so there is no need for us to use the comma after “please note” whenever we start a sentence in this way. Correct: Please note that I ...
